About Baxter International Inc

Baxter International Inc (NYSE: BAX) is a medical products company that develops, manufactures, and sells hospital and renal care products used in acute and chronic care settings. Revenue is generated through the direct sale of medical devices, intravenous therapies, pharmaceuticals, and nutritional products to h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are providers. As of its 10-K filed February 12, 2026, Baxter completed a significant portfolio restructuring, selling its Kidney Care business (now Vantive Health LLC) to Carlyle Group affiliates on January 31, 2025 for approximately $3.71 billion in pre-tax cash proceeds. Baxter used the net after-tax proceeds, along with other sources, to repay $3.81 billion in legacy indebtedness during FY2025. The Kidney Care segment is reported as discontinued operations in Baxter's FY2025 consolidated financials, meaning the continuing business is now focused on its remaining hospital products and therapies segments.

Revenue model
Transactional product sales to hospitals, clinics, and healthcare institutions. Products include medical devices, IV solutions, and pharmaceuticals sold directly to healthcare providers.
Products and services
Intravenous therapies, hospital pharmaceuticals, nutritional products, medical devices, and renal care products (Kidney Care segment divested to Vantive Health LLC on January 31, 2025, reported as discontinued operations in FY2025 financials per 10-K filed 2026-02-12).
Customers and end markets
Hospitals, acute care clinics, and other healthcare institutions. End markets include acute hospital care settings.
Value-chain role
Medical product manufacturer and direct seller to healthcare providers.
